跳转至

Java SE Runtime Environment 8 Downloads 深度解析

简介

Java SE Runtime Environment 8(Java 标准版运行时环境 8,简称 JRE 8)是运行 Java 应用程序必不可少的组件。它提供了 Java 虚拟机(JVM)、Java 核心类库以及支持文件,使得开发好的 Java 程序能够在各种操作系统上顺利运行。了解如何正确下载和使用 JRE 8,对于 Java 开发者和相关技术人员至关重要。本文将详细介绍 JRE 8 的下载、使用方法、常见实践以及最佳实践,帮助读者更好地掌握这一技术。

目录

  1. 基础概念
    • Java SE Runtime Environment 8 是什么
    • JRE 8 与 JDK 8 的区别
  2. 下载 JRE 8
    • 官方网站下载
    • 其他下载渠道
  3. 使用方法
    • 安装 JRE 8
    • 配置环境变量(以 Windows 为例)
    • 验证安装是否成功
  4. 常见实践
    • 运行 Java 应用程序
    • 在浏览器中运行 Java Applet
  5. 最佳实践
    • 定期更新 JRE 8
    • 安全设置与管理
  6. 小结
  7. 参考资料

基础概念

Java SE Runtime Environment 8 是什么

JRE 8 是 Java 平台的一部分,它为运行 Java 应用程序提供了必要的环境。它包含了 JVM,这是 Java 程序的运行核心,负责执行字节码;Java 核心类库,提供了丰富的 API 用于各种功能,如输入输出、字符串处理、集合框架等;以及支持文件,如配置文件和资源文件。

JRE 8 与 JDK 8 的区别

JDK 8(Java Development Kit 8)是 Java 开发工具包,它包含了 JRE 8 以及开发 Java 程序所需的工具,如编译器(javac)、调试器(jdb)等。JDK 主要面向 Java 开发者,用于开发新的 Java 应用程序、小程序和组件。而 JRE 8 主要用于运行已经开发好的 Java 程序,普通用户在运行 Java 应用时只需要安装 JRE 8 即可。

下载 JRE 8

官方网站下载

  1. 打开浏览器,访问 Oracle 官方的 Java 下载页面:Java SE 8 Downloads
  2. 在页面中选择适合你操作系统的 JRE 8 版本进行下载。例如,如果你使用的是 Windows 64 位系统,就选择相应的 Windows x64 版本。
  3. 下载前可能需要接受 Oracle 的许可协议。

其他下载渠道

除了官方网站,一些可靠的第三方软件下载平台也提供 JRE 8 的下载。但要注意选择信誉良好的平台,以确保下载的文件安全可靠,没有被篡改。

使用方法

安装 JRE 8

  1. Windows 系统
    • 找到下载好的 JRE 8 安装文件(通常是一个.exe 文件),双击运行它。
    • 在安装向导中,按照提示逐步进行操作,如选择安装路径(默认路径一般为 C:\Program Files\Java\jre1.8.0_xx,xx 为版本号),点击“下一步”直到安装完成。
  2. Mac OS 系统
    • 双击下载的.dmg 文件,打开磁盘映像。
    • 将 JRE 图标拖移到“Applications”文件夹中进行安装。

配置环境变量(以 Windows 为例)

  1. 右键点击“此电脑”,选择“属性”。
  2. 在弹出的窗口中,点击“高级系统设置”。
  3. 在“系统属性”窗口中,点击“环境变量”按钮。
  4. 在“系统变量”区域中,找到“Path”变量,点击“编辑”。
  5. 在“编辑环境变量”窗口中,点击“新建”,添加 JRE 8 的 bin 目录路径,例如 C:\Program Files\Java\jre1.8.0_xx\bin(xx 为版本号),然后点击“确定”保存设置。

验证安装是否成功

  1. 打开命令提示符(在 Windows 中,按下 Windows + R 键,输入“cmd”并回车)。
  2. 在命令提示符中输入 java -version,如果安装成功,会显示 JRE 8 的版本信息,例如:
java version "1.8.0_xx"
Java(TM) SE Runtime Environment (build 1.8.0_xx-bxx)
Java HotSpot(TM) 64-Bit Server VM (build 25.xx-b02, mixed mode)

常见实践

运行 Java 应用程序

假设我们有一个简单的 Java 应用程序 HelloWorld.java,代码如下:

public class HelloWorld {
    public static void main(String[] args) {
        System.out.println("Hello, World!");
    }
}
  1. 使用 JDK 编译 HelloWorld.java 文件,生成字节码文件 HelloWorld.class(如果没有 JDK,可使用在线编译器如 IDEOne 进行编译)。
  2. 确保 JRE 8 已经安装并配置好环境变量。
  3. 打开命令提示符,进入 HelloWorld.class 文件所在的目录。
  4. 输入命令 java HelloWorld,即可运行该应用程序,输出“Hello, World!”。

在浏览器中运行 Java Applet

Java Applet 是一种嵌入在网页中的小型 Java 程序。 1. 编写一个简单的 Java Applet 代码 MyApplet.java

import java.applet.Applet;
import java.awt.Graphics;

public class MyApplet extends Applet {
    public void paint(Graphics g) {
        g.drawString("This is a Java Applet", 20, 20);
    }
}
  1. 使用 JDK 编译 MyApplet.java 生成 MyApplet.class
  2. 创建一个 HTML 文件 applet.html,内容如下:
<!DOCTYPE html>
<html>
<head>
    <title>Java Applet Example</title>
</head>
<body>
    <applet code="MyApplet.class" width="200" height="200"></applet>
</body>
</html>
  1. 打开支持 Java 的浏览器,访问 applet.html 文件,即可看到 Applet 的运行效果。

最佳实践

定期更新 JRE 8

Oracle 会定期发布 JRE 8 的更新版本,这些更新通常包含安全补丁和性能优化。定期更新 JRE 8 可以确保系统的安全性和稳定性。在 Oracle 官方网站上可以找到最新的 JRE 8 更新并进行下载安装。

安全设置与管理

  1. 限制 Applet 权限:如果在浏览器中运行 Java Applet,要根据实际需求合理设置 Applet 的权限,避免潜在的安全风险。可以通过 Java 控制面板进行相关设置。
  2. 安全策略配置:对于企业环境,可以通过配置 Java 安全策略文件,对 Java 应用程序的访问权限进行更细粒度的控制。

小结

本文详细介绍了 Java SE Runtime Environment 8 的下载、使用方法、常见实践以及最佳实践。通过了解 JRE 8 的基础概念,掌握正确的下载和安装步骤,以及在不同场景下的使用方法,读者可以更好地运行和管理 Java 应用程序。同时,遵循最佳实践原则可以提高系统的安全性和性能。希望本文能帮助读者深入理解并高效使用 JRE 8。

参考资料